Pamela Ann Nolen, 60, of Knoxville, TN passed away peacefully at home on Monday, January 18, 2016. Pam was a loving daughter, sister and aunt. She had many friends and greeted all who had the privilege of knowing her with a big smile and a loving hug. Pam was born on November 4, 1955 in Knoxville, TN. She was a member of Smithwood Baptist Church where she was a devoted member of Soul Sister Sunday School Class. Pam was an avid University of Tennessee football and basketball fan and had a lifelong love of Peyton Manning and Elvis Presley. Life with Pam was always entertaining, from her brothers hiding her Little Debbie cakes, which usually resulted in a chase, to the annual competition at Christmas and birthdays to see who had the gift that would make her so happy she would cry.

She is preceded in death by her beloved father, Ed Nolen and nephews, Matthew Cooper and Zane Bruhin.
